#b69faf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b69faf is composed of 71.4% red, 62.4%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.6%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 318.3 degrees, a saturation of 13.6% and a lightness of 66.9%. #b69faf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d3f5f.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#b69faf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040304 is the darkest color, while #faf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b69faf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0a6ac is the less saturated color, while #fe58cb is the most saturated one.
